EEP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2018 in Review

245 of the 4,363 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Enbridge Energy Partners (EEP) for Q1 2018, worth a combined $1.18B — down 40% from $1.98B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 44 funds closed out of EEP and 29 opened new positions — a net loss of 15 holders — while 86 trimmed existing stakes and 56 added.

The largest buyer was Citigroup, adding an estimated $28.8M. The largest seller was Tortoise Capital Advisors, cutting an estimated $133M.
